      <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Sliding Glass Patio Door Repairs: A Comprehensive Guide</p>

<hr>

<p>Moving glass patio doors are a popular choice for house owners, providing a smooth shift in between indoor and outside areas while enabling natural light to flood in. Nevertheless, like any other part of a home, they can come across problems gradually. In this post, we will check out typical issues faced by sliding glass patio doors, how to identify these issues, and the steps to take for efficient repairs. We&#39;ll also supply an in-depth FAQ section at the end to address some typical concerns.</p>

<p>Typical Issues with Sliding Glass Patio Doors</p>

<hr>

<p>Before diving into repair work, it&#39;s vital to recognize the typical issues property owners face with moving glass patio doors. Understanding these issues can help you identify what repair or upkeep jobs are essential.</p>

<p><strong>Issue</strong></p>

<p><strong>Description</strong></p>

<p>Split or Broken Glass</p>

<p>Glass panels can crack or shatter due to impacts, weather condition conditions, or age.</p>

<p>Off-Track Door</p>

<p>The door may slide off its track due to debris, wear and tear, or improper installation.</p>

<p>Problem Opening/Closing</p>

<p>This can happen due to misalignment, accumulation of dirt in the tracks, or worn-out rollers.</p>

<p>Drafts or Water Leaks</p>

<p>Poor sealing or damaged weather condition stripping can result in drafts and water leakages, jeopardizing energy performance.</p>

<p>Broken Locks or Handles</p>

<p>Locks or deals with can break due to excessive force or age, jeopardizing security and ease of use.</p>

<p>Misted or Foggy Glass</p>

<p>This problem happens when the seal in between double-pane glass panels fails, triggering condensation to form.</p>

<p>Identifying the Problem</p>

<hr>

<p>As soon as you&#39;ve identified an issue, it&#39;s vital to detect the problem properly. Here are some actions to take:</p>
<ol><li><strong>Inspect the Door</strong>: Start by taking a look at the whole moving glass door, looking for noticeable cracks, misalignments, or indications of wear.</li>
<li><strong>Inspect the Track</strong>: Remove any debris from the track, guaranteeing that it is clean and devoid of blockages.</li>
<li><strong>Test the Rollers</strong>: If the door is difficult to open or close, inspect the rollers for wear. You might require to replace them if they are damaged.</li>
<li><strong>Analyze the Seals</strong>: Inspect the weather condition removing around the door to see if it is intact. If you see any gaps or damage, this might be the source of drafts or leakages.</li>
<li><strong>Assess the Glass</strong>: If you observe fogging in between double panes, think about that the seal might be broken and needs replacement.</li></ol>

<p>Fixing Common Issues</p>

<hr>

<h3 id="1-cracked-or-broken-glass" id="1-cracked-or-broken-glass">1. <strong>Cracked or Broken Glass</strong></h3>

<p><strong>Repair Steps</strong>:</p>
<ul><li><strong>Temporary Fix</strong>: Use clear packaging tape to hold the glass briefly.</li>
<li><strong>Professional Help</strong>: Hire a professional to change the entire panel if the glass is shattered.</li></ul>

<p><strong>Expense Estimate</strong>: ₤ 200 – ₤ 600 (depending upon the door size and type).</p>

<h3 id="2-off-track-door" id="2-off-track-door">2. <strong>Off-Track Door</strong></h3>

<p><strong>Repair Steps</strong>:</p>
<ul><li><strong>Remove the Door</strong>: Lift the door and carefully pull it out of the track.</li>
<li><strong>Tidy the Track</strong>: Thoroughly clean the track to remove dirt and debris.</li>
<li><strong>Re-align the Door</strong>: Place the wheels back into the track and guarantee it is level.</li></ul>

<p><strong>Expense Estimate</strong>: ₤ 50 – ₤ 100 in materials if you need to replace rollers.</p>

<h3 id="3-difficulty-opening-closing" id="3-difficulty-opening-closing">3. <strong>Difficulty Opening/Closing</strong></h3>

<p><strong>Repair Steps</strong>:</p>
<ul><li><strong>Clean the Rollers and Track</strong>: Spray a lube specifically created for moving doors.</li>
<li><strong>Replace Rollers</strong>: If they are worn, replace them with new ones.</li></ul>

<p><strong>Expense Estimate</strong>: ₤ 10 – ₤ 30 for roller replacement.</p>

<h3 id="4-drafts-or-water-leaks" id="4-drafts-or-water-leaks">4. <strong>Drafts or Water Leaks</strong></h3>

<p><strong>Repair Steps</strong>:</p>
<ul><li><strong>Replace Weather Stripping</strong>: Remove old weather stripping and change it with brand-new adhesive-backed material.</li>
<li><strong>Adjust the Door</strong>: Ensure that it closes securely versus the frame.</li></ul>

<p><strong>Expense Estimate</strong>: ₤ 20 – ₤ 50 for weather condition stripping.</p>

<h3 id="5-broken-locks-or-handles" id="5-broken-locks-or-handles">5. <strong>Broken Locks or Handles</strong></h3>

<p><strong>Repair Steps</strong>:</p>
<ul><li><strong>Remove the Old Handle/Lock</strong>: Unscrew the existing hardware and install the brand-new one according to producer instructions.</li></ul>

<p><strong>Expense Estimate</strong>: ₤ 15 – ₤ 100 depending on the type of lock or handle.</p>

<h3 id="6-misted-or-foggy-glass" id="6-misted-or-foggy-glass">6. <strong>Misted or Foggy Glass</strong></h3>

<p><strong>Repair Steps</strong>:</p>
<ul><li><strong>Consider Glass Replacement</strong>: This issue typically requires professional support to replace the insulated glass unit.</li></ul>

<p><strong>Cost Estimate</strong>: ₤ 300 – ₤ 700 based upon door size and intricacy.</p>

<p>Preventative Maintenance</p>

<hr>

<p>To prolong the life of moving glass patio doors and reduce repair requirements, property owners need to stay up to date with regular upkeep. Here are some tips:</p>
<ul><li><strong>Regular Cleaning</strong>: Keep the tracks clear of dirt and debris by cleaning them frequently with a vacuum or damp cloth.</li>
<li><strong>Lubrication</strong>: Apply lube to the rollers and track every 6 months to guarantee smooth operation.</li>
<li><strong>Weather Condition Stripping Check</strong>: Inspect weather condition stripping each year to replace any broken areas.</li>
<li><strong>Visual Inspections</strong>: Perform a fast visual examination every couple of months to recognize prospective issues before they escalate.</li></ul>
